Senior Automation Engineer
Our Partner in Tipperary area develops and supplies the active ingredients and final formulated product for a range of innovative medicines at its manufacturing and R&D facilities. The plant, which has been operating in Tipperary for over 40 years, exports to over 25 countries around the world with primary markets being Europe, USA and Japan. They are searching for a Senior Automation Engineer to work an 11 month contract as part of a large project on site.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ities for this Senior Automation Engineer role include, but are not limited to, the following:
- As the senior Automation Engineer, you will Manage Automation vendors and provide clear direction for the Automation team.
- Develop and/or review SDLC deliverables, compliant with company standards.
- Ensure delivery of code is robust, stable and delivers a system which runs compliantly and efficiently in conformance with company standards for infrastructure, DI and throughput needs of business.
- Work closely with vendors of Automation equipment to ensure deliverables meet project requirements, including the interfacing of new Automation equipment with existing site systems, incl. MES and PI Historian.
- Work closely with the QA-IT and CSV functions and ensure their requirements are met in all deliverables.
- Fluent in English, written and verbal.
- Minimum of 6 years’ experience in a similar role in the Pharmaceutical industry.
- Strong experience in the following systems: Siemens S7 PLC, WinCC SCADA and HMIs
- Experience in one or all of the following systems would be advantageous: Other PLC, SCADA and HMIs, Siemens Desigo, OSISoft PI, RT Reports, PasX MES.
